We are pleased to announce that Caroline Doll '14 and Zoe Guy '14 were accepted into the 2013 Look Up To Cleveland Class. Look Up To Cleveland is a high school leadership development and diversity awareness program for Greater Cleveland’s outstanding high school leaders. Students are chosen in their junior year to develop leadership and citizenship skills and to learn about and appreciate the Cleveland community. The organization was founded in 1986 by the League of Women Voters of the Cleveland Educational Fund and alumni of Leadership Cleveland. In 2006 it became part of the Cleveland Leadership Center.
These students were chosen from a highly selective group of nominees based on leadership ability, a strong academic record, civic activity in school and/or the community and demonstrated self-reliance, independence and initiative.
